Product reviews:
Jonathan
2025-03-23 iphone 11
Buy Giant Peppa Pig Talking Soft Toy giant peppa pig stuffed animal
giant peppa pig stuffed animal
Montague
2025-03-20 iphone 11 Pro Max
Peppa Pig Family Plush Doll Stuffed Toy giant peppa pig stuffed animal
giant peppa pig stuffed animal
What better than a giant Peppa pig to giant peppa pig stuffed animal
giant peppa pig stuffed animal